It seems that kernel nfsd consumes an inordinate amount of CPU time
during writes on this machine. With a few hundred kb/sec being written
over NFSv3 from a 2.2.17 client, all of the nfsd threads each consume as
much of the available CPU time as possible. On a similarly configured
machine with ext3 instead of reiserfs, nfsd consumes much less CPU time.
Is there a known issue with NFSv3 performance and reiserfs?
